Abstract

The utility model discloses a stand on concrete assembled basis, this stand is truncated conical tip, and lower part cavity. The utility model discloses the stand dead weight is lighter, convenient transportation.

Description

A kind of column on concrete assembled basis
Technical field
This utility model relates to a kind of column, specifically for one for concrete floor column structure assembling type base.
Background technology
Along with China's economic development and the raising of circuit transmission capacity, in power circuitry engineering, the most once the Guywire tower of a large amount of uses, prefabricated assembled basis were gradually replaced by self-supporting steel tower and cast-in-place basis.
But there is the problems such as speed of application is slow, labor intensity is big, construction environment is poor in cast-in-place foundation construction, part form of construction work fails to take into full account the requirement of environmental conservation, bigger with advanced international standard gap.The modularized design of assembling type base optimized integration component, batch production processing, mechanized construction, be greatly reduced on-the-spot Manual moist workload and operation, improve efficiency of construction and construction quality.Assembling type base achieves the recycling of basic material, is the Major Strategic putting into practice whole-life cycle fee theory, is the important development direction that project of transmitting and converting electricity is built from now on.
The defects such as the many employings of existing concrete assembling type base prefabricated solid slab rod structure, although bearing capacity is strong, it is little to deform, antiseptic property good, but it is big to there is member dead weight, transport and installation difficulty are big.
Summary of the invention
The purpose of this utility model is to solve defect present in prior art, it is provided that the column that a kind of deadweight is lighter.
In order to achieve the above object, this utility model provides the column on a kind of concrete assembled basis, and this column is circular cone shape, and lower hollow.
This utility model column includes upper and lower two parts, and top is divided into the frustum of a cone, bottom to be divided into hollow circuit cylinder;The frustum of a cone is fixedly linked with hollow circuit cylinder.
Wherein, frustum of a cone lower hollow, and hollow space be connected with hollow circuit cylinder formation column hollow parts;Hollow circuit cylinder or the frustum of a cone are provided with injected hole;Injected hole is connected with column hollow parts.
The frustum of a cone is made up of the frustum tile that four sizes are identical;Hollow circuit cylinder is made up of the cylinder tile that four sizes are identical.
It is connected by curved bolt between the frustum tile and the cylinder tile that are connected between adjacent frustum tile, between adjacent cylinder tile, up and down.
Outside frustum tile and cylinder tile, being provided with groove at bolts assemblies, be provided with through hole in groove, bolt is located in the through hole of correspondence.Colophonium or cement mortar it is filled with in groove.
This utility model has the advantage that column design, for the impact of adaptation level power column, is become frustum by this utility model compared to existing technology.Simultaneously in order to alleviate the deadweight of column, is left a blank in column bottom.And column is divided into each 4 each single components of upper and lower two-layer, effectively control length and the weight of single-piece, convenient transport.Column lower hollow section reserves injected hole simultaneously, can irrigate packing material as required, increases basis deadweight.This utility model column can be widely used for electric power line pole tower assembling type base.

Detailed description of the invention
Below in conjunction with the accompanying drawings this utility model is described in detail.
As it is shown in figure 1, this utility model column includes upper and lower two-layer, upper strata is the frustum of a cone 1, and lower floor is hollow cylinder 2.The frustum of a cone 1 lower hollow, and be connected with the hollow parts of lower floor hollow cylinder 2, collectively constitute column hollow parts 3.In conjunction with Fig. 2, the frustum of a cone 1 is made up of the frustum tile 11 that four sizes are identical, and four frustum tiles 11 are symmetrical along the axis of the frustum of a cone 1;Hollow cylinder 2 is made up of the cylinder tile 21 that four sizes are identical, and four cylinder tiles 21 are symmetrical along the axis of hollow cylinder 2.In order to increase basis deadweight, column is reserved with injected hole (not shown), is connected with column hollow parts 3, packing material can be irrigated as required.For meeting the performance requirement of concrete sheet-pile, the frustum of a cone 1 a diameter of 800mm of upper surface, a diameter of 1200mm of lower surface of this utility model column, it is highly 1600mm, lower hollow part is circular cone shape (a diameter of 540mm of upper surface, a diameter of 700mm of lower surface, height is 600mm).The height of hollow cylinder 2 is 1050mm, and inside diameter is 700mm, and outer dia is 1200mm.
In conjunction with Fig. 3, between adjacent frustum tile 11, between adjacent cylinder tile 21, it is connected by curved bolt 4 between the frustum tile 11 and the cylinder tile 21 that are connected up and down.Outside frustum tile 11 and cylinder tile 21, being provided with groove 5 at the assembling of curved bolt 4, be provided with through hole in groove 5, curved bolt 4 is located in the through hole of correspondence.After curved bolt 4 has fastened, Colophonium or the floating groove of cement mortar 5 can be used to strengthen anticorrosion.
